[effects/slidingpopups] Unconditionally force background contrast
Summary: Force background contrast same way blur is forced. Reviewers: #kwin, davidedmundson Reviewed By: #kwin, davidedmundson Subscribers: kwin Tags: #kwin Differential Revision: https://phabricator.kde.org/D14092icc-effect-5.14.5
